Failure to finish second could trigger a Roma revolution, with reports indicating Walter Mazzarri and Marco Branca could arrive.

Current sporting director Walter Sabatini has admitted to mistakes in the transfer market in the last two windows, including signing the injured Victor Ibarbo.

Meanwhile, despite two wins in a row, Coach Rudi Garcia is under pressure as Lazio sit just one point behind in third place.

SportMediaset claims that a failure to finish as runner-up to Juventus could see both leave, with an Inter reunion in their place.

Walter Mazzarri was replaced at San Siro earlier this season by Roberto Mancini, while Branca was sacked as sporting director in February last year.

The former could replace Garcia if he’s poached by Paris Saint-Germain to replace Laurent Blanc, who is expected to leave at the end of this season.

Branca, meanwhile, could arrive if Sabatini is sacked or resigns.
